A special event to mark the 75th anniversary of the first Goon Show broadcast.
Directed by Terry Johnson
In the late 70’s, National Treasure Spike Milligan toured his one man show around the world. Twice.
Jeremy Stockwell recreates that evening of unique, absurd, surreal flights of fancy. Featuring stories, poems, gags, and Goonery; expect a roller-coaster ride through the life of Spike; a sixty minute homage to the man who defined a golden age of British comedy.
Jeremy Stockwell, renowned for his brilliant and multi-layered embodiment of Spike, will once more conjure this iconic legend. Jeremy will be joined by Spike’s daughter Jane and the very talented Matthew Deveraux on Keys, together they will perform some previously unheard songs composed by Spike.
The show is a must-see for all fans of Milligan and his glittering comic heritage.
